Abstract
Disclosed is a medical diagnostic device for analyzing breath gases and/or skin emissions, including a highly sensitive sensing component for obtaining an emission concentration profile and a database of breath analysis profiles medical condition characteristics.

16. A method for utilizing a concentration profile in a breath sample to assist in the diagnosis of a medical condition, the method comprising:
-
measuring the concentration profile of a particular gaseous analyte in said breath sample with a nanosensor comprising a sensing electrode containing unlabeled urea as a substrate tuned for measuring said particular gaseous analyte; and
comparing the detected amounts of said gaseous analyte to a baseline to assist in diagnosis of a medical condition.
